An Indiana environmental lobby group says much of the legislation dealing with the environment this session is addressing issues left over from the last year.

Indy Politics spoke with Tim Maloney, the head of policy for the Hoosier Environmental Council.

Maloney says there is legislation that impacts agriculture, energy and logging in state parks, either addressing issues that were unresolved from the 2017 session or popped up after lawmakers had adjourned.
